In Episode 25 Pastor Daron and Daniel break down the R.C. Sproul document "The Sensuous Christian", and in this episode, the conversation continues, this time with an emphasis on "Emotional Legalism". The term "Emotional Legalism" comes from Pastor Jerry Wragg and Pastor Paul Shirley's book, "Free to Be Holy".
Emotional Legalism is a legalism that binds your conscience and your life to a new set of laws governed by your emotions instead of by biblical truth and conviction. It tends to govern your sense of right and wrong and your own spirituality based on how you feel about it instead of what the Scriptures say, and how the Spirit of God moves and works in the inner life of a person through the Word of God united with faith in the believer.
